Foreign Minister Dimitrij Rupel received in Ljubljana on Monday Polish Culture Minister Kazimierz Michal Ujazdowski for talks on bilateral relations. The officials agreed that relations between the countries were good, the Foreign Ministry said in a press release.
According to Rupel and Ujazdowski, bilateral cooperation is being developed at various levels and areas, including within the regional partnership, the Central European Initiative, and the Salzburg Forum.
The legal basis for the cooperation between Slovenia and Poland in this field is provided by the agreement on cooperation between the two governments in education, culture and science, and in the accompanying programmes for the 2003-2006 period.
Slovenian language courses are organised at Polish universities in Krakow, Warsaw, Katowice and Lodz. Poland and Slovenia also cooperate within the cultural platform of the Central European countries and the Forum of Slavic Cultures.
